Controlled synthesis of non-noble metal nanocatalysts with tailored structures and morphologies for targeted catalytic performance is one of the main topics in current catalysis research. In this proposal, a catalytic chemical vapor deposition (CCVD) method is proposed to synthesize Fe-C alloy nanocatalysts with tailored structures and morphologies by controlling the growth of carbon nanofibers (CNFs). The influences of the operating conditions of CCVD on the stable surface structures and the surface morphologies of Fe-C alloy nanocatalysts will be studied by combining ab initio atomistic thermodynamics simulation and experiments. The Fe-C alloy nanocatalysts will be used for ammonia decomposition and its activity at low temperatures and stability at high temperatures will be evaluated. DFT calculations will be employed to understand how carbon atoms influence the structures and electronic properties of Fe for increased activity and inhibit the nitridation of Fe for prolonged stability. Microkinetic analysis will be conducted and used to establish LHHW kinetics to understand the kinetic behaviors of Fe-C alloy nanocatalysts with different structures and morphologies. The CCVD method proposed for Fe-based nanocatalysts and the approaches used to understand the structure-performance relationship can also be extended to other non-noble metal catalysts, such as Ni and Co. This research is valuable not only for rational design of Fe-based catalysts with excellent performances, but also for in-depth understanding of the role of C in structural and morphological manipulation of metal catalysts.
特定结构和形貌的非贵金属纳米催化剂的可控制备及其形貌效应是当前催化领域中的热点课题之一。 本申请提出采用CCVD法通过调控纳米碳纤维的生长制备具有特定结构和形貌的Fe-C合金纳米催化剂的新思路。结合从头计算原子级热力学模拟和实验研究,建立反应条件与Fe-C合金稳定结构以及表面形貌的对应关系,以实现特定结构和形貌的Fe-C合金纳米催化剂的可控制备。以氨分解为模型反应体系,考察催化剂的活性和高温稳定性,并结合DFT计算,阐明C原子对催化剂结构特性、电子特性以及氮化过程的影响。通过对氨分解Fe-C合金纳米催化剂的微观反应动力学分析,建立LHHW动力学模型,阐明催化剂结构以及形貌对其动力学行为的影响。 上述调控催化剂结构和形貌的方法也适用于制备可生长纳米碳纤维的Ni、Co等非贵金属催化剂。本项目研究成果不仅可用于指导高效Fe基催化剂的理性设计,还有助于深入理解C对金属催化剂结构和形貌的调控机制。
特定结构和形貌的过渡金属纳米催化剂的可控制备及其形貌效应是当前催化领域中的热点课题之一。目前,国内外对纳米催化剂形貌效应的研究主要针对贵金属,很少针对非贵金属。本项目提出“采用催化化学气相沉积(CCVD)法实现特定结构和形貌的Fe-C合金纳米催化剂的可控制备”的新思路,并从实验和理论上证实了其可行性,同时探究了该方法的普适性,发现CCVD法也适用于制备特定结构和形貌的Ni-C合金纳米催化剂;系统研究了CCVD技术参数对Fe-C、Ni-C合金纳米催化剂形貌与晶相结构的影响,并结合理论计算,揭示了C原子吸附诱导以及石墨烯单元与金属晶面的匹配性是非贵金属纳米催化剂结构与形貌可控合成的内因;比较研究了该类新型催化剂与传统负载型催化剂之间的氨分解活性、高温稳定性以及动力学特征,发现CCVD法制备的催化剂尽管粒径较大,但是其活性以及稳定性明显优于传统等量浸渍法制备的催化剂,同时两种方法制备的催化剂活性趋势相反:传统负载型Ni纳米催化剂氨分解活性高于Fe纳米催化剂,但形貌可控Fe-C合金纳米催化剂的氨分解活性反而高于Ni-C合金纳米催化剂;进一步结合理论计算,揭示了表面C以及次表面C对Fe、Ni催化剂上氨分解性能的影响机制,发现其影响规律呈现出相反的趋势;最终,建立了明确的催化剂结构与氨分解性能之间的构-效关系,为基于CCVD技术制备出高效氨分解非贵金属Fe、Ni纳米催化剂提供了理论基础和实践指导。
